2007 Citroen C5 vs. 2008 Renault Scenic

To start off, 2008 Renault Scenic is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2007 Citroen C5.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2007 Citroen C5 would be higher. At 1,998 cc (4 cylinders), 2008 Renault Scenic is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Renault Scenic (133 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 25 more horse power than 2007 Citroen C5. (108 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2008 Renault Scenic should accelerate faster than 2007 Citroen C5.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Citroen C5 weights approximately 42 kg more than 2008 Renault Scenic.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Citroen C5 (241 Nm @ 1750 RPM) has 50 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Renault Scenic. (191 Nm @ 3750 RPM). This means 2007 Citroen C5 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Renault Scenic.

Compare all specifications:

2007 Citroen C5 2008 Renault Scenic
Make Citroen Renault
Model C5 Scenic
Year Released 2007 2008
Body Type Station Wagon Minivan
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1560 cc 1998 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 108 HP 133 HP
Engine RPM 4000 RPM 5500 RPM
Torque 241 Nm 191 Nm
Torque RPM 1750 RPM 3750 RPM
Engine Bore Size 75 mm 82.7 mm
Engine Stroke Size 88 mm 93 mm
Fuel Type Diesel Gasoline - Premium
Top Speed 186 km/hour 195 km/hour
Acceleration 0-100mph 13.1 seconds 10.3 seconds
Drive Type Front Front
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1517 kg 1475 kg
Vehicle Length 4850 mm 4270 mm
Vehicle Width 1790 mm 1820 mm
Vehicle Height 1560 mm 1630 mm
Wheelbase Size 2760 mm 2690 mm
Fuel Consumption Overall 5.5 L/100km 8.3 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 66 L 60 L
